Citadel drops U.S. Portofino suit

- Citadel Securities quietly abandoned its multi‑year U.S. trade‑secrets lawsuit against Portofino after securing a judgment in the UK and shifting focus to collection. - The firm won roughly £6 million in a UK arbitration and chose to prioritize a collectible enforcement path over parallel U.S. litigation. - The move underscores a pragmatic, expected‑value approach to legal strategy; Citadel also joined a separate U.S. insider‑trading suit tied to China broker crackdowns.
